컨트롤 파일 (Control file)
컨트롤 파일은 데이터베이스의 Physical 구조를 기록하는 파일.
DB를 마운트, 열기 및 사용하는 데 필요한 파일이므로 컨트롤 파일이 손상된 경우 Oracle을 마운트하거나 열 수 없음.
따라서 두 개 이상의 컨트롤 파일을 백업하고 다른 디스크에 저장해야함. 또한 복구에 필요한 동기화 정보를 저장.
컨트롤 파일에는 데이터베이스 이름, 위치, 테이블스페이스 이름, 온라인 리두 로그 파일의 위치, 파일크기, 데이터베이스 생성 타임 스탬프, 현재 로그 시퀀스 번호 및 체크포인트 정보,백업정보 등이 포함
<컨트롤 파일 관련 뷰>
V$CONTROLFILE: 컨트롤 파일 이름과 상태표시
V $ PARAMETER: 파라미터 표시
예시 SQL> SHOW PARAMETER CONTROL_FILES;
V $ CONTROLFILE_RECORD_SECTION: 컨트롤파일 레코드 섹션 정보
<컨트롤 파일 백업>
ALTER DATABASE BACKUP CONTROLFILE TO '/oracle/backup/control.bkp';
ALTER DATABASE BACKUP CONTROLFILE TO TRACE;
출처:
'IT Tool Box' 카테고리의 다른 글
갤럭시 S7 무한재부팅 + 갤럭시 S10 언락폰 구매 후기 (1) | 2020.05.23 |
---|---|
Oracle 12c 아키텍처 SGA란? shared pool, db 버퍼 캐시, large pool, java pool (2) | 2020.05.15 |
남(친)이 산 닌텐도 스위치 매우 주관적 후기(feat 디아블로3) (1) | 2020.05.06 |
CentOS 8 설치 "Section %packages does not end with %end. Pane is dead” 에러 (0) | 2020.04.24 |
디지털 노마드를 꿈꾸시는 분들을 위한 프리랜서 사이트 모음 (0) | 2020.04.09 |